fosborb posted:

Paladin/Commander is one of the strongest classes in the game, flat out. You hit hard on your turn and you have heals/protection and on everyone else's turn you become the indispensable reroll engine and you get to really gently caress the GM over when they roll poorly. It's a monster
I guess my question is - do I understand this right? You have two different basic attacks and you need to decide which one?

I'm guessing he'll also need the Armored talent from the Commander if he wants to stay in plate?
